We are proud to present you the newest member of the TANKIA family. The name of the new car is Gloria and she is a completely new development. Instead of the KTM motor, the drivetrain consists of two electric wheel hub motors with planetary gearbox on the rear axle.

Technical Data
Drivetrain
- 2x in-wheel (35 kW and 29.1 Nm) with 3D printed cooling housing
- oil-lubricated planetary gearbox with two-step planets
- water cooling circuit for motors and inverter
- 3D-printed brake calipers on the front axle
- one-piece milled aluminum brake caliper on the rear axle
HV-Electronics
- Samsung 21700 Li-Ion round cells
- max. voltage: 567 V
- self-developed Motor-Control-Unit
- Capacity: 9,7 kWh
LV-Electronics
- digital driver cockpit with multifunction steering wheel
- 4 CAN-Bus systems
- smaller, more powerful PCBs
- live telemetry via GSM
Aerodynamics
- CFD- optimized aeropackage
- Front-, rearwing and undertray fabricated from CFRP
- driver actuated, pneumatic DRS-System with active Aero-Balance-System on the frontwing
- High efficiency
Chassis
- one-piece Carbon Monocoque, optimized for electric drive
- CFRP-Impact Attenuator
Suspension
- one-piece CFRP A-arms
- springs and dampers actuated via rockers, pushrod front and back
- 10″ CFRP rim, Hoosier 16.0 x 6.0 – R10
